        You asked about larding needles. It has been a long time since I
used one. Well what it is used for is to lace a lean pice of meat with a
little fat. Fat is always good for flavour.

For memory there are several varieties of larding needles, you should be
able to find one in any reputable kitchenwares shop. The one that I am
familiar with is a long stainless steel needle (knitting needle size) that
is hollow. Fat is inserted into one end and then you insert the needle under
the skin or just jab it in and then press down on the plunger in the other
end, much the same as a hypodermic needle.
